Equipment Operation Spray nozzles suffer from caking on the outside and clogging on the inside. When the nozzle is below the bed surface, fast capture of the liquid drops by bed particles, as well as scouring of the nozzle by particles, prevents caking. Blockages inside the nozzle are also common, particularly for slurries. The nozzle design shoiild be as simple as possible and provision for in situ cleaning or easy removal is essential. [Pg.1897]

With regards to this it is clear that the wafer pretreatment is of key importance for obtaining good selectivity. Such pretreatments can vary from wet clean steps to in situ dry clean steps. In situ clean steps have the advantage that they can be done in vacuo in an integrated (cluster) tool. Unfortunately not much has been published in the literature about the in situ pretreatments. In one study a NF3 plasma is reported to be able to remove native oxide from silicon [Kajiyana et al.84]. [Pg.73]

On the basis of laboratory and field tests accomphshed in the USA an in-situ cleaning of groundwater containing MTBE can be achieved by cultivating plants. In a field study, poplars were planted downstream of a MTBE plume. The calculated reduction of MTBE concentration in the groimdwa-ter amounted to approximately 37-67% within 10 days [18]. However, the examination of applicabihty of phytoremediation requires field tests. It is conceivable that phytoremediation could be used if high order subjects of protection are not directly concerned and if the necessary reaction area and time can be accepted. [Pg.268]

The deposition step is usually preceded by an in situ cleaning step to remove residual organics. Cleaning is carried out in an Ar/02 plasma. Typical conditions are 60% Ar, 40% O2 ... [Pg.28]

Isocyanates react with hydrated oxide layers on metal surfaces, thus producing an in-situ clean surface, and therein most probably allowing the urea groups of the adhesive to form chemical bonds with the residual valencies of the metal lattice. [Pg.224]

The rate of absorption within plants depends on the species, redox potential, and Fe presence. The P. vittata has a higher potential for in situ cleaning-up of arsenic-contaminated soils and suggests that As phytoextraction is a constitutive property in P. vittata. [Pg.242]
